- Greet all visitors entering the community, answer questions, ensure visitors sign guest sheets, and direct phone calls to the proper residents and staff.
- Sort, deliver and collect incoming/outgoing community and resident mail; may perform basic office/clerical functions and maintain visitor logs.
- Respond to resident emergencies by calling appropriate internal and external parties based on community protocol.
- Previous reception or front‑desk experience preferred.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ills.
- Ability to handle multiple tasks and prioritize responsibilities.
- Comfortable with phone systems and basic computer applications.
- Adaptable and responsive to emergencies and changing priorities.
